The external URL handler service is used for finding platform-specific applications for handling particular URLs.
1.0
28
Introduced
Gecko 2.0
Inherits from:
nsISupports
Last changed in Gecko 2.0 (Firefox 4 / Thunderbird 3.3 / SeaMonkey 2.1)Method overview
nsIHandlerInfo getURLHandlerInfoFromOS(in nsIURI aURL, out boolean aFound); |
Methods
getURLHandlerInfoFromOS()
Given a URL, looks up the handler info from the operating system. This should be overridden by each operating systems implementation.
nsIHandlerInfo getURLHandlerInfoFromOS( in nsIURI aURL, out boolean aFound );
Parameters
aURL
- The URL we are looking for.
aFound
- Was an operating system default handler for this URL found?
Return value
An nsIHanderInfo
for the protocol.